Dog Grooming Services: Choosing Properly

If you don't know the best way to clip your growing puppy's nails or don't like giving them haircuts, dog grooming services are readily available in most parts of the country. However, because they're so common, it's easy to imagine that you'll just need to set an appointment and leave it at that. However, to ensure good, clean care that is comfortable for your dog, you should think about these grooming selection suggestions.

1-Drop By First

A visit is perhaps the best way to see with your own two eyes what the space is truly like. You can glance at dogs who are currently being washed and clipped to gauge their comfort levels. You can see whether urine and feces are quickly cleaned. You can scan surfaces for excessive hair buildup or other mess. If the space seems neat and both groomers and dogs seem to be in pleasant moods, you may have found a good location.

2-Inquire About Certification

Experience is always handy when handling different animals, and a simple way you can discover information about groomers who might work on your own dog is to ask the director or contact person about any documentation or certification they possess. Many states ask that groomers display their certification in the waiting room or on the main door, so if you don't see it during your visit, ask about how long the certification has been in place and whether it's standards apply to everyone in the company or just the owner.

3-Know Emergency Protocol

If your dog has a health emergency while in their care, you must be aware of whatever protocols exist so you know how to handle the situation without becoming overly agitated or upset. A vague idea isn't sufficient; know who will call and tell you something has occurred, as well as what your next steps should be. This permits you to work with a calm head if your dog should become injured.

4-Discuss Your Dog

Groomers should be quite used to making a dog feel at ease during hair cutting or bathing, but it's wise to give them some information which will help them keep your dog in control. For example, you can share words you use to discourage behavior or tell them about where the dog likes to be pet.

Grooming services can keep your dog looking beautiful, but you must also ensure their safety and calmness. Talk about all these grooming issues with staff members so you can all be in agreement about how to best work with your dog.
